How G21K's grant cadence moved
Between 2020–2024, G21K recorded 1,143 grants versus 1,466 in 2015–2019 (-22% equal-window velocity). Across complete years, output peaked in 2015 at 321 grants and bottomed in 2023 at 188 (+71% peak-over-trough). Lead assignee Carl Zeiss SMT GmbH holds 4.3% of the class ; the top three share 8.7%.

Where G21K sits inside G21
Among 8 subclasses in G21 (Nuclear PHYSICS; Nuclear Engineering), G21K ranks #1 and holds 33.6% of the parent class's 8,981 recorded grants. Sibling chips below are the other subclasses in the same parent class, not the nationwide volume/lead-share peers further down.
